Dawnspire Domination - E-mail Battles. Rules
An e-mail battle game over 6 rounds.
The idea is as follows. 2 players decide they want to challange each other to an e-mail battle. First they both create an e-mail with the same title, for an example lets use Hullu vs Swiss. Next they choose a class, then six of the skills from that classes set of 10. Some of the skills will have to be rewritten slightly/completely so that they fit the game. We need a balance between attack and defence. Anyway once they have chosen there 6 skills (attack/defence), trying to second guess there opponents, they post these e-mails to a scorer. The scorer as you would guess then scores the match and posts the results on a sticky thread.
As I said some of the skills will have to be rewritten. I am trying to keep this easy for the scorer to score, so no levels per skill. all skills are max level. All characters also have the same amount of life. no % of damage done. It's straight up damage or save.
The following rules wouuld be set in stone.
attack vs attack = both sides take damage. attack vs defence = defence wins all the time. If an attack does damage over rounds then only the round the defence is used would that damage be cancelled. Some defences will be set up to do a small amount of return damage. defence vs defence = nothing much happens. Each skill can only be used once so there is no chance of anyone spamming defence skills all game. If a player uses a skill more than once in a game he loses the game automatically. As it would be to much hassle for the scorer to e-mail back and forth.
We could also set up a league table with a win getting you 3 points and a draw 1 point.
You win a game if after 6 rounds you have killed your opponent or have more life left.

An example of a fight between 2 Prowlers. Both players have 350 hp. All players have 350 hp.
Player one player 2 Round 1 Multi (atk) vs Call companion (atk) Player 1 takes 100dmg and goes to 250hp Player 2 takes 72 damage and falls to 278
Round 2 Suppressive (atk) vs reinvigorate (def) Player 1 takes no damage stays at 250hp player 2 takes no damage this round stays at 278
Round 3 Shriek (def) vs Multi (atk) Player 1 takes no damage as he defends Stays at 250hp Player 2 takes 45 dmg from shriek+40 dmg from Suppressive goes to 193hp
Round 4 Aimed (atk) vs Shriek (atk) Player 1 takes 45 damage and goes to 205hp Player 2 takes no dmg from aimed and blocks the dmg from Suppressive 193hp.
Round 5 Reinvigorate (def) vs Aimed (atk) Player 1 takes no dmg stays at 205hp Player 2 takes 40 dmg from the last round of suppressive goes to 153hp.
Round 6 Call (atk) vs Sacrafice (def) Player 1 takes no damage as 205hp Player 2 takes no dmg as bird absorbed blow stays at 153hp.
Player 1 wins with higher hit points gets 3 league points.
